About Dr. Arrojas

Dr. Alfredo Arrojas is a board-certified orthopaedic surgeon who specializes in total joint reconstruction. He has extensive training in robotic-assisted total knee, total hip, and partial knee replacements as well as direct anterior and revision total hip replacement, revision total knee replacement, and cementless total knee arthroplasty. In his practice, he strives to keep his patients informed through shared decision-making and treating them as if they were part of his family.

After graduating with a Bachelor of Science degree from Florida International University in Miami, Dr. Arrojas earned his Doctor of Medicine degree from Drexel University College of Medicine in Philadelphia, Pennsylvania. He then attended Palmetto Health/University of South Carolina in Columbia to complete an orthopaedic surgery residency. Dedicating an additional year to specialty training, Dr. Arrojas earned a total joint reconstruction fellowship from The CORE Institute in Phoenix, Arizona. He is board-certified by the American Board of Orthopaedic Surgery and is also Mako-certified to perform total and partial knee replacements and total hip replacements.

Dr. Arrojas is fluent in Spanish, and when he is not seeing patients, he likes to play golf and other sports. He also enjoys photography, visiting saltwater aquariums.

Elizabeth Wingard is a certified physician assistant working alongside Dr. Alfredo Arrojas and specializing in total joint reconstruction. Elizabeth earned her undergraduate degree from the University of Florida and completed Nova Southeastern University’s Physician Assistant Program in 2014. She has prior clinical experience in plastic surgery, wound care, and orthopaedics.
